SAIR 3X0-201 Exam Syllabus Topics:
| Section | Weight | Objectives |
|---|---|---|
| Topic 1: System Installation & Configuration | 15% | - Disk partitioning and filesystems - Kernel configuration and modules - Boot process and bootloaders |
| Topic 2: Backup, Recovery & Troubleshooting | 10% | - Backup strategies and tools - System recovery and rescue mode - Performance and issue diagnosis |
| Topic 3: Security & Hardening | 15% | - Encryption and secure communications - Audit logs and intrusion detection - File security and access control |
| Topic 4: User & Group Administration | 10% | - Authentication and PAM - User and group creation/modification - Sudo and privilege management |
| Topic 5: Filesystem & Storage Management | 15% | - Mounting, quotas and maintenance - Filesystem hierarchy and permissions - Logical Volume Manager (LVM) |
| Topic 6: System & Package Management | 20% | - Scheduling jobs and automation - Process management and monitoring - System services and runlevels/targets - Package managers (RPM, DEB, YUM, APT) |
| Topic 7: Networking & Connectivity | 15% | - DNS, DHCP and network services - Firewall rules and packet filtering - TCP/IP configuration and routing |
